Steering Lock
0
The key can be withdrawn in this
position only. The steering is
locked with the key removed from
the steering lock.
The key can be removed only with
the selector lever in position "P".
After removing the key or with the
key in steering lock position 0, the
selector lever is locked in posi­
tion "P".
1
Steering is unlocked.
(If necessary, move steering
wheel slightly to allow the key to
be turned clockwise to position 1.)

2
Preglow and driving position.
3
Starting position.
For starting and turning off the engine,
refer to page 14.
Warning!
When leaving the vehicle always
remove the key from the steering
lock. Do not leave children
unattended in the vehicle. Unsu­
pervised use of vehicle equip­
ment may cause serious person­
al injury.
Notes:
The following items can be operated
with the key in steering lock position 1:
Wiper,
windshield washer system,
headlamp cleaning system (only in
exterior lamp switch positions -00;
ID).
or
headlamp flasher,
lighter,
glove box lamp,
sliding roof,
rear window defroster,
power windows,
power seats, front and rear,
heated seats, front,
orthopedic seat backrest,
telescopic steering column.
An audible warning will sound when
the driver's door is opened with the
key in steering lock position 1 or 0.
With the engine at idle speed, the
charging rate of the alternator (output)
is limited.
It is therefore recommended to turn off
unnecessary electrical consumers
while driving in stop-and-go traffic.
This precaution helps to avoid
draining the battery.
Unnecessary strain on the battery and
charging system may be minimized by
turning off the following power
consumers, for example: Heated
seats, rear window defroster.
